Milford, De vs Sandanski Climate & Distance Between

Bulgaria flag
  • The distance between Milford, De, Usa and Sandanski, Bulgaria is approximately 7,839 km or 4,872 mi.
  • To reach Milford, De in this distance one would set out from Sandanski bearing 305.3° or NW and follow the great circles arc to approach Milford, De bearing 231.8° or SW .
  • Both have a humid subtropical climate (Cfa).
  • Both are in or near the cool temperate moist forest biome.
  • The annual mean temperature is 0.8 °C (1.4°F) cooler.
  • Average monthly temperatures vary by 1.7 °C (3.1°F) more in Milford, De. The continentality subtype is subcontinental for both.
  • Total annual precipitation averages 623.2 mm (24.5 in) more which is equivalent to 623.2 l/m² (15.29 US gal/ft²) or 6,232,000 l/ha (666,242 US gal/ac) more. About 2 2/7 as much.
  • The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 2.5° higher in Milford, De than in Sandanski.
